# Watchdog settings for the Ortano kiosk fleet.
# The watchdog process restarts the kiosk shell if the heartbeat table
# goes stale for more than 90 seconds. It runs under a restricted
# service account with read/write access limited to the heartbeat and
# incident tables only; schema changes are blocked at the role level.
# All restarts are logged for audit. The watchdog reaches its state
# database via the connection string defined on the next line.

replica DSN, yahaf-yagaf: mongodb://tamath_svc:a2netSk3RZMuTj@db-d084.novacsoft.internal:5432/ralmir

**Q: How is the user-profile store sharded?**

By user ID, hashed across 64 shards in the Plinth cluster. Shard maps live in `config/shards.yaml`. Never write to a shard directly; go through the Plinth client, which handles routing and retries. Resharding is automated — do not run the migration scripts manually. If a shard shows hot-key warnings, file a ticket rather than rebalancing yourself. Access requires the contractor role grant, requested through your team lead. For shard-map questions or access issues, write to the address below.

alerts address for yajof-kahog: eliax@qirvanlabs.corp

## Runbook: Slabdiff large-file viewer — restart after OOM

Slabdiff chokes on repos with binary blobs over the chunk limit; the symptom is a stuck spinner and the worker pegged at max memory. Kill the render worker, clear the chunk cache under the scratch volume, and restart the service. Do not raise the chunk limit without sign-off from the Perth-on-Marle platform team — it multiplies memory use. After restart, confirm the process came up with the expected settings, which are listed below.

config for kagup-hahig:
druwyn:
  pin: 2801
  metrics_host: metrics.druwyn.zemvarlabs.internal
  tenant: sorius
  seal: seal_798a43d7

Handover note for the Pewterbird admin dashboard. Dark-mode support shipped last sprint; theme choice persists per user and falls back to system preference. Support should know that a few legacy charts still render light backgrounds until the next patch. Everything theme-related is driven by the settings below, which the dashboard reads at startup.

service settings:
holix:
  log_level: debug
  metrics_host: metrics.holix.zemvarsys.internal
  pool_size: 16